|
GHOST参数详解:8 V& g+ e$ q& l3 n+ ?
1 P/ R3 A. }# ^; s9 j$ Q0 A
1 k. c2 t! P2 ^; ]
-rb 本次Ghost操作结束退出时自动重启。这样,在复制系统时就可以放心离开了。
( N; a/ {# S1 A. K5 L -fx 本次Ghost操作结束退出时自动回到DOS提示符。
% ]1 U! D1 K9 i% H, J -sure 对所有要求确认的提示或警告一律回答“Yes”,和-CLONE选项一起使用来4 e2 |- J0 N5 P, k4 h5 F. ?
避免提问。此参数有一定危险性,只建议高级用户使用。
2 m I3 }, c# d7 k4 e" j- k ` -fro 如果源分区发现坏簇,则略过提示强制拷贝。此参数可用于试着挽救硬盘
3 i- S9 o7 m& B1 q坏道中的数据。
5 ]0 v l O ^2 j @filename 在filename中指定txt文件。txt文件中为Ghost的附加参数,这样做+ Y- G- V. y8 x
可以不受DOS命令行150个字符的限制。
1 z2 R$ T2 v6 L V+ Z -f32将源FAT16分区拷贝后转换成FAT32(前提是目标分区不小于2G)。WinNT4和
' Q: u7 C! Z! GWindows95、97用户慎用。 . V0 z. i" t L& R# @
-bootcd 当直接向光盘中备份文件时,此选项可以使光盘变成可引导。此过程
# t4 C/ H) f4 {5 n5 K8 T需要放入启动盘。 . G, [6 {& q/ S0 }3 `; j. K
-fatlimit 将NT的FAT16分区限制在2G。此参数在复制Windows NT分区,且不想
4 i# g+ T y8 n M, x, @2 y使用64k/簇的FAT16时非常有用。
3 Y# B1 W) u6 [0 {! w! N -span 分卷参数。当空间不足时提示复制到另一个分区的另一个备份包。
* O$ @* T9 P; v -auto 分卷拷贝时不提示就自动赋予一个文件名继续执行。
" ?. O* d) N) w6 g" u$ h" P7 H -crcignore 忽略备份包中的CRC ERROR。除非需要抢救备份包中的数据,否则不
5 H" r ]1 `) v% G要使用此参数,以防数据错误。 2 w2 z; m+ z! u; M3 o
-ia 全部映像。Ghost会对硬盘上所有的分区逐个进行备份。 ) [* g. @ U( q) ~" ^3 P: l' C
-ial 全部映像,类似于-ia参数,对Linux分区逐个进行备份,对其它分区则用
) R' B- k1 K' _; F' c5 g& C7 x0 k3 J# T正常方法。 ) I8 s, _8 M5 s
-id 全部映像。类似于-ia参数,但包含分区的引导信息。 2 s- l& N4 b* w0 {+ a
-quiet 操作过程中禁止状态更新和用户干预。
9 H- N" w" W% d -script 自动按照脚本文件中的命令来运行程序,可以执行多个Ghost命令行,
0 I3 H( c. N( p命令行存放在指定的文件中。 1 a2 f9 P" ^( P# i( f5 h$ a; h
-span 启用映像文件的分卷功能。
1 w1 D; u: D8 k4 |$ y -split=x 将备份包划分成多个分卷,每个分卷的大小为x兆。这个功能非常
! h; f: `/ w' Z. n8 v& W& \实用,用于大型备份包复制到移动式存储设备上,例如将一个1.9G的备份包复制到6 ~* X: p3 W/ Z7 a1 {
3张刻录盘上。 $ L" P0 V; v- _1 F2 D
-z 将磁盘或分区上的内容保存到映像文件时进行压缩。-z或-z1为低压缩率
2 z- y0 z3 p$ Q, r. s5 I/ v2 U(快速);-z2为高压缩率(中速);-z3至-z9压缩率依次增大(速度依次减慢)。 0 B4 Y& y2 S5 X
-clone 这是实现Ghost无人备份/恢复的核心参数。; u- C6 D; B- |/ r0 q- Q/ `
使用语法为:
0 O/ q' Z/ L& p& E7 g5 |' ^4 h -clone,MODE=(operation),SRC=(source),DST=(destination),[SZE(size),9 [' f& C( ^/ v1 f1 [; |7 I3 [
SZE(size)......] # L x0 c6 ^7 C7 A
此参数行较为复杂,且各参数之间不能含有空格。 $ C: j4 r2 v2 m. S6 w F( G: H! Q
其中operation意为操作类型,值可取:copy:磁盘到磁盘;load:文件到磁盘;3 x* t2 n6 o- I7 g& |. [" B" J; F1 m
dump:磁盘到文件;pcopy:分区到分区;pload:文件到分区;pdump:分区到文件。
+ A9 Q/ ~; B$ R+ I' HSource意为操作源,值可取:驱动器号,从1开始;或者为文件名,需要写绝对路径。
/ ~$ l" h& ~+ m" Y# }! I) D' nDestination意为目标位置,值可取:驱动器号,从1开始;或者为文件名,需要写- U; x% t( B2 m2 W7 m8 [
绝对路径;@CDx,刻录机,x表示刻录机的驱动器号,从1开始。 5 g. u* `9 C* @- e, k8 f
: o K, ~( F1 X: N2 B6 }! w 下面举例说明:
8 F4 T3 V; m' m, x6 r! @: ~- o* k 命令行参数:ghost -clone,mode=copy,src=1,dst=2 / l# q0 h. j7 M) W
完成操作:将本地磁盘1复制到本地磁盘2。
3 l# a! d$ |. J9 s$ T1 U+ \
- }/ O5 N# C. O2 ] 命令行参数:ghost -clone,mode=pcopy,src=1:2,dst=2:1 2 N" b# s1 H# }. ~& W" g
完成操作:将本地磁盘1上的第二分区复制到本地磁盘2的第一分区。
+ w: {5 w' |& o9 z7 Y K7 b4 x: D# U& r7 c" W! }% N8 K# Z2 f
命令行参数:ghost -clone,mode=load,src=g:\3prtdisk.gho,dst=1,
2 W9 E$ o' @0 E5 v) d esze1=450M,sze2=1599M,sze3=2047M ) ?' i2 X5 S" z1 j H A
完成操作:从映像文件装载磁盘1,并将第一个分区的大小调整为450MB,. e: e3 I& P8 R4 |3 Q( |
第二个调整为1599MB,第三个调整为2047MB。
m: u8 `% w" A
4 O) e3 l/ i1 M9 S/ z( c! g 命令行参数:ghost -clone,mode=pdump,src2:1:4:6,dst=d:\prt246.gho ; W- N# M9 b0 l- `0 Y
完成操作:创建仅具有选定分区的映像文件。从磁盘2上选择分区1、4、6。
7 W# K5 p( v1 Z2 d. J了解了这些参数后,我们就可以轻松地实现Ghost的无人备份/复制/恢复了。
1 U2 m5 y4 F9 z+ P冲杯咖啡吧。 " n: n8 N3 {! ^
. w. |/ _ k5 W& \9 C- m. F9 Q) k GHOST8.0参数首次支持对NTFS中GHO文件的读写,如,第1硬盘第1分区是NTFS格式,
. f% b( L& c& F( u在2003和其它更早版本执行 src=1:1:\c.gho 类似这样的语句时会报错,现在好了,
: v5 H4 |8 Z+ ~. w$ Y8.0得到了完美的支持.
2 r( n; Y# I$ H& h5 g# Y! | ]2 j" a$ b S% S& a+ M
+ Q7 r! N' q3 y
注意事项 - y; D) y0 _" A) V; @
1.在备份系统时,单个的备份文件最好不要超过2GB。
+ I' K8 o5 R" O7 ]+ |! e a% T 2.在备份系统前,最好将一些无用的文件(如win386.swp)删除以减少Ghost文件的0 M1 s: ~" X" m- \+ x; V
体积。通常无用的文件有:Windows的临时文件夹、IE临时文件夹、Windows的内存& J; V1 I, u" E- n! ]8 @0 k# @
交换文件。这些文件通常要占去100多兆硬盘空间。 3 ?; L# X8 l* ^! v* U
3.在备份系统前,整理目标盘和源盘,以加快备份速度。
$ N) Z1 z% ]& P, r 4.在备份系统前及恢复系统前,最好检查一下目标盘和源盘,纠正磁盘错误。
+ d3 I; y5 a3 K( ^) a7 A 5.在恢复系统时,最好先检查一下要恢复的目标盘是否有重要的文件还未转移,
( {" ?1 W1 V! m4 Z千万不要等硬盘信息被覆盖后才后悔莫及啊。
* O+ `( I! Q6 V; b4 H: C1 ? 6.在选择压缩率时,建议不要选择最高压缩率,因为最高压缩率非常耗时,而# `+ |' o( C: M* i" V
压缩率又没有明显的提高。
/ h7 J, Y) V6 Y8 c4 T 7.在新安装了软件和硬件后,最好重新制作映像文件,否则很可能在恢复后出现9 ?# c: Q' T- y) D" D1 \6 X
一些莫名其妙的错误。 8 Q; ] `; l* x$ H, H. R$ L
2 Z+ \) K) z7 M4 O- S) N3 }+ a (二) 不常用参数:4 g K, f+ z% a7 p% x. T2 g) d
2 h0 ?* J2 O ^
-IR:和ID一样,但不将分区调整为扇区界限。
; B3 o0 m' M* N2 H, n -IB:只复制磁盘的启动扇区。 8 P5 t# T$ ?( _% l: d l) Q
-OR:覆盖空间并进行完整性检查。 % z7 J X% N2 A- ?
-NOLILO:复制后不要试图去修正LILO启动调入器。
& w. e+ u0 c( p -FDSZ:清除目标磁盘上的标志性字节。 " @1 `, |3 p" l$ `
-FDSP:保留目标磁盘上的标志性字节。(优先级高于-FSSZ)
) |6 X% R6 @8 _/ F. l. J5 R6 a -LPM:LPT主并行连接模式。
: c' l+ A; v) [' A) B -LPS:LPT从并行连接模式。 3 P+ g U2 Z# D P- c
-TCPM:TCP/IP主连接模式。
p: R' p6 M$ h -TCPS:TCP/IP从连接模式。
: u1 H- g8 u( S3 ]8 O; U$ s -USBM:自动进入USB主模式。 : i! N! a" W, Q3 r) B% a" @$ w
-USBS:自动进入USB从模式。
D2 {9 C& \! `, M2 c7 H -JL:记录多点传送会话诊断消息到文件。
* S4 y+ e$ l: v7 }8 S -JS:设置最大的多点传送值。
1 E/ V: b3 n( S -JA:设置多点传送会话的名称。 - c4 n$ }+ b: Q& B. h6 @
-CHKIMG:检查映象文件的完整性。
. G) p5 S2 \5 Q; P5 i9 ^* y3 O -PWD:指定密码。
9 {1 G. a& A" H# }6 C i7 `* V -SKIP:指定需要跳过的FAT文件系统中的文件或目录。 6 Y8 `# e, r6 }; J$ \, o* y
-PMBR:当进行任何磁盘复制操作时,保留目标磁盘中的主引导记录。
/ d. K/ W* A4 T- D! f4 b9 B' i3 h% m -F64:当调入旧映象文件时允许64K的簇大小。
. C2 ^2 U3 ~* ~6 T -FATLIMIT:防止FAT分区大小超过2兆。 9 J1 ^4 L: m' h9 ~$ N
-NTD:允许NTFS内部诊断检查。
# m/ E" f" x/ w1 m0 r. U# d -NTC-:禁止NTFS连续簇分配。
3 I; x% L4 I2 [. k* Q' t7 H! v; f -NTCHKDSK:强制CHKDSK在下一个NTFS卷启动。 ; M/ \3 j; d) C& y8 n; H' H
-NTIC:忽略NTFS卷上的CHKDSK位。
: K; s& l+ `1 P1 s -NTIL:忽略非空的NTFS日志文件检查位。 - o4 `" H% I, B+ F. r
-NTIID:忽略分区系统标识符的复制。 * O) t/ U8 G$ R) _& t$ }
-TAPEBUFFERED:默认的磁带模式。
2 f. R% f4 b& k0 r) L* [& S -TAPESAFE:当使用旧的或不可靠的磁带时有用。
' s* H. A! Z2 D" I7 g: U6 m$ r -TAPESPEED:允许控置磁带速度。 0 ^3 v4 e, _" q( B+ R' O
-TAPEUNBUFFERED:强制非缓冲的磁带输入输出。
, W: ]/ n5 T0 ]. Y8 e2 s9 T( l2 T -TAPEEJECT:强制磁带操作完后弹出。 % f; C& J# W" e" e; T1 G) @
-TAPEBSIZE:磁带块大小。 2 E: _+ E! R5 B9 B1 X1 k( N
-NOFILE:禁止文件询问。
) T8 V% _# p' g% t -DL:指定存在的硬盘号。 ( ?2 V1 `% H; h8 N
-FIS:使用检测出的硬盘最大值。 ; C" x7 Z. H) n$ G# k
-FNX:禁止扩展13号中断支持。 ! Q& R) Z1 w! }5 ^1 R$ _7 ^
-FFX:使用扩展13号中断。 1 J5 M" M2 x! M+ ]% t3 u
-FNI:禁止直接IDE硬盘存取支持。 $ ?$ a1 o2 j* r: X0 ^
-FFI:使用直接IDE硬盘存取。
4 `/ v/ l# v" N5 N# f. Z; x -FNS:禁止直接ASPI/SCSI硬盘存取支持。
6 Q+ B, ^) @" f; G [) I! ` -FFS:使用直接ASPI/SCSI硬盘存取。 . p1 n3 `( ?% n) v; c
-NOSCSI:禁止使用ASPI存取SCSI设备。 5 l8 v2 i2 r; r3 K
-BFC:处理坏的FAT簇。 + m f7 P& Z$ _' e9 {
-VDM:写入前使用使用磁盘校验命令来检查磁盘上的每个扇区。
p, A- j1 f2 G* n7 S -CRC32:使用CRC32校验。
( q6 T4 V* I, x -FCR:当建立文件时创建校验文件。 + U6 g6 b/ O3 o. W2 j
-AFILE:使用指定的中止记录文件。
0 |! \1 @' b6 a* M' a* b -DI:显示诊断。
1 C } V+ a# y. I$ s2 Y: J4 l1 S# Q -MEMCHECK:诊断内存。 6 r# B/ H- v5 R6 I" ]! g9 {
-DD:记录磁盘信息到GHSTSTAT.TXT : `3 F; W& V3 R3 |( U# R/ A/ T% @
-DFILE:使用指定的信息日志文件。 5 v! M0 v0 S; M
-FINGER:显示详细的指纹信息。
( ~5 o. i: a2 o+ Y8 A, h& w -VER:显示程序版本号。 |
|